Curtain wall convenient to install and high in stability for building
Technical Field
The utility model relates to a building correlation technique field specifically is a curtain for building that installation stability is high of being convenient for.
Background
The building is an indispensable part in people's life, no matter be office building, market and residential area house etc. and the curtain is a article of hanging in the building outer wall, can play certain guard action or increase aesthetic measure, but this curtain has some shortcomings:
firstly, the common curtain wall is troublesome to install and low in stability, and is very inconvenient to fix only through bolts and the like;
secondly, as above, the curtain wall is fixed through materials such as screw, can not adjust the angle, and is comparatively inconvenient when needs clearance or need adjust the position according to light.
SUMMERY OF THE UTILITY MODEL
The utility model aims to provide a curtain wall which is convenient for installation and has high stability for construction, so as to solve the problem of inconvenient installation and poor stability in the prior art; the integral angle is not convenient to adjust.
In order to achieve the above object, the utility model provides a following technical scheme: a curtain wall convenient for mounting and high in stability for buildings comprises a wall body, a hand wheel, a curtain wall main body and an expansion screw, wherein the upper surface of the wall body is penetrated through by the hand wheel, the bottom surface of the hand wheel is fixedly connected with a fixing column, the bottom surface of the fixing column is fixedly connected with a first bevel gear, the lower surface of the first bevel gear is connected with a second bevel gear, the front side surface of the second bevel gear is fixedly connected with a screw rod, the lower surface of the screw rod is connected with a transmission gear, the transmission gear is fixedly arranged on the outer surface of a cylindrical block, the cylindrical block penetrates through the left side surface of the wall body, the cylindrical block is fixedly arranged on the right side surface of the curtain wall main body, the left side surface of the curtain wall main body is penetrated through by a supporting column, the supporting column is fixedly arranged on the right side surface of the bottom end of a connecting block, the right side surface of the top end of the connecting block is fixedly connected with a lug, and the lug penetrates through the left side surface of the wall body, one side surface of the connecting block is penetrated through by the expansion screw, the expansion screw penetrates through one side surface of the guide block, the outer surface of the guide block is fixedly connected with a limiting block, the limiting block and the guide block are located in the inner groove, and the inner groove is formed in the left side surface of the wall body.
Preferably, the hand wheel and the fixing column form a rotating structure with the wall, and the first bevel gear and the second bevel gear on the fixing column are in meshed connection.
Preferably, the screw rod is in meshed connection with the transmission gear, and the transmission gear, the screw rod and the cylindrical block form a rotating structure with the wall body.
Preferably, the curtain wall main body is connected with the supporting column in a clamping mode, and the central axis of the supporting column is matched with the central axis of the cylindrical block.
Preferably, the front surfaces of the connecting block, the convex block and the supporting column are in a C shape, and the connecting block and the guide block are in threaded connection with the expansion screw.
Preferably, the guide block and the wall body form a clamping sliding structure through a limiting block and an inner groove, and the limiting block is symmetrically distributed about the transverse center line of the guide block.
Compared with the prior art, the beneficial effects of the utility model are that: the curtain wall for the building is convenient to install and has high stability,
1. the transmission gear on the cylindrical block can be plugged into the wall body to be clamped with the screw rod, so that a first-step clamping effect is achieved, the cylindrical block is clamped on the curtain wall at the moment, the connecting block is clamped in the wall body through the bump to achieve a second clamping effect, and then only one expansion screw needs to be driven in to fix the connecting block and the guide block to achieve a third clamping effect, so that the stability is improved, and the installation is convenient;
2. the accessible is rotatory the hand wheel for the hand wheel drives the rotatory and second conical gear meshing of first conical gear on the fixed column, orders about second conical gear and drives the rotatory and drive gear meshing of screw rod, can drive the curtain behind the drive gear meshing and rotate through the support column, through screw rod and drive gear's self-locking function, reaches rotation angle of adjustment's effect.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-5, the present invention provides a technical solution: a curtain wall convenient for mounting and high in stability for buildings comprises a wall body 1, a hand wheel 2, fixing columns 3, a first bevel gear 4, a second bevel gear 5, screws 6, transmission gears 7, a cylindrical block 8, a curtain wall main body 9, a connecting block 10, a bump 11, an expansion screw 12, a guide block 13, a limiting block 14, an inner groove 15 and a supporting column 16, wherein the upper surface of the wall body 1 is penetrated through by the hand wheel 2, the fixing columns 3 are fixedly connected to the bottom surface of the hand wheel 2, the first bevel gear 4 is fixedly connected to the bottom surface of the fixing columns 3, the second bevel gear 5 is connected to the lower surface of the first bevel gear 4, the screws 6 are fixedly connected to the front side surface of the second bevel gear 5, the transmission gears 7 are connected to the lower surface of the screws 6, the transmission gears 7 are fixedly arranged on the outer surface of the cylindrical block 8, the cylindrical block 8 penetrates through the left side surface of the wall body 1, the cylindrical block 8 is fixedly arranged on the right side surface of the curtain wall body 9, and the left side surface of the curtain wall main body 9 is penetrated by the supporting column 16, and the supporting column 16 is fixedly arranged on the bottom right side surface of the connecting block 10, the top right side surface of the connecting block 10 is fixedly connected with the bump 11, and the bump 11 penetrates through the left side surface of the wall body 1, one side surface of the connecting block 10 is penetrated by the expansion screw 12, and the expansion screw 12 simultaneously penetrates through one side surface of the guide block 13, and the outer surface of the guide block 13 is fixedly connected with the limiting block 14, the limiting block 14 and the guide block 13 are both positioned in the inner groove 15, and the inner groove 15 is arranged on the left side surface of the wall body 1.
Hand wheel 2 and fixed column 3 all constitute rotating-structure with wall body 1, and first conical tooth wheel 4 on the fixed column 3 is connected for the meshing with second conical tooth wheel 5, and when hand wheel 2 was rotatory, hand wheel 2 can drive fixed column 3 rotatory for fixed column 3 drives first conical tooth wheel 4 rotatory, lets first conical tooth wheel 4 rotatory and second conical tooth wheel 5 meshing drive screw rod 6 rotatory.
The screw rod 6 is in meshed connection with the transmission gear 7, the screw rod 6 and the cylindrical block 8 form a rotating structure with the wall body 1, and the screw rod 6 can be meshed with the transmission gear 7 when rotating, so that the transmission gear 7 drives the cylindrical block 8 to rotate after being meshed.
The curtain wall main part 9 is connected for the block with support column 16, and the central axis of support column 16 is identical with the central axis of cylinder piece 8, when curtain wall main part 9 was fashionable with the support column 16 block, because support column 16 is the cylinder, and the central axis of support column 16 is identical with the central axis of cylinder piece 8, can make and drive curtain wall main part 9 when cylinder piece 8 rotates and use support column 16 to rotate as the axle center, reach angle regulation's effect.
Connecting block 10, lug 11 and support column 16's front view is "C" font, and connecting block 10 and guide block 13 all are threaded connection with inflation screw 12, after carrying out the block with lug 11 and support column 16 on connecting block 10 respectively with wall body 1 and curtain main part 9, rethread inflation screw 12 is fixed connecting block 10 and guide block 13 for lug 11 and support column 16 on the connecting block 10 do not deviate from wall body 1 and curtain main part 9, improve stability.
The guide block 13 forms a sliding structure of the clamping with the wall body 1 through the limiting block 14 and the inner groove 15, the limiting block 14 is symmetrically distributed about the transverse center line of the guide block 13, the clamping support column 16 is driven to rotate when the curtain wall main body 9 rotates, the support column 16 drives the connecting block 10 to rotate, at the moment, the connecting block 10 and the guide block 13 are both fixed by the expansion screw 12, and therefore the guide block 13 can slide in the wall body 1 through the limiting block 14 and the inner groove 15.
The working principle is as follows: when the curtain wall with high stability is convenient to install for a building, according to the figures 1, 2, 4 and 5, firstly, the cylindrical block 8 is plugged into the wall body 1, the transmission gear 7 is clamped with the screw rod 6, the first layer of clamping is completed at the moment, then the support column 16 on the connecting block 10 is clamped with the curtain wall main body 9, at the moment, the convex block 11 can be clamped in the wall body 1 to achieve the second layer of clamping, and then the expansion screw 12 is used for fixing the connecting block 10 and the guide block 13 to achieve the third layer of clamping, so that the effect of convenient installation is achieved, and the stability is improved;
after the installation, according to fig. 1, fig. 2, fig. 3 and fig. 4, the hand wheel 2 can be rotated by the aid of the hand wheel 2, the hand wheel 2 drives the first bevel gear 4 on the fixed column 3 to rotate to be meshed with the second bevel gear 5, the second bevel gear 5 is driven to drive the screw rod 6 to rotate to be meshed with the transmission gear 7, the transmission gear 7 drives the cylindrical block 8 to rotate at the moment, the curtain wall main body 9 on the cylindrical block 8 rotates along with the first bevel gear, the support column 16 drives the connecting block 10 to rotate, the connecting block 10 drives the guide block 13 to slide in the inner groove 15 through the limiting block 14 through the expansion screw 12, the convex block 11 also slides in the wall body 1 along with the second bevel gear, the effect of adjusting the angle in a rotating mode is achieved, and the overall practicability is improved.
